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 15 Aug 2013 22:13:42 +0000 (UTC)
From:      Brendan Fabeny <bf@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r324786 - in head/math: R libmissing
Message-ID:  <201308152213.r7FMDggR040206@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: bf
Date: Thu Aug 15 22:13:42 2013
New Revision: 324786
URL: http://svnweb.freebsd.org/changeset/ports/324786

Log:
  Update math/libmissing to 20130815, and adjust a dependent port

Modified:
  head/math/R/Makefile
  head/math/libmissing/Makefile
  head/math/libmissing/distinfo

Modified: head/math/R/Makefile
==============================================================================
--- head/math/R/Makefile	Thu Aug 15 21:37:32 2013	(r324785)
+++ head/math/R/Makefile	Thu Aug 15 22:13:42 2013	(r324786)
@@ -115,13 +115,13 @@ CONFIGURE_ENV +=	SHLIB_${flag}FLAGS="${P
 
 .if ${PORT_OPTIONS:MMISSING}
 LIB_DEPENDS+=		missing:${PORTSDIR}/math/libmissing
-LIBM=			-L${LOCALBASE}/lib -lmissing
+LIBM=			-lm -L${LOCALBASE}/lib -lmissing
 LIBMH=			"missing_math.h"
 .if defined(LIBRMATH_SLAVEPORT)
 CPPFLAGS+=		-I${LOCALBASE}/include
 .endif
 .else
-LIBM=			-lquadmath
+LIBM=			-lm -lquadmath
 LIBMH=			<quadmath.h>
 .endif
 

Modified: head/math/libmissing/Makefile
==============================================================================
--- head/math/libmissing/Makefile	Thu Aug 15 21:37:32 2013	(r324785)
+++ head/math/libmissing/Makefile	Thu Aug 15 22:13:42 2013	(r324786)
@@ -1,7 +1,7 @@
 # $FreeBSD$
 
 PORTNAME=	libmissing
-DISTVERSION=	20121222
+DISTVERSION=	20130815
 CATEGORIES=	math
 MASTER_SITES=	LOCAL/bf
 
@@ -10,7 +10,7 @@ COMMENT=	Standard math functions missing
 
 LICENSE=	BSD
 
-LIB_DEPENDS=	mpc:${PORTSDIR}/math/mpc
+LIB_DEPENDS=	libmpc.so:${PORTSDIR}/math/mpc
 
 USE_LDCONFIG=	yes
 USE_XZ=		yes
@@ -25,7 +25,7 @@ PLIST_FILES=	include/missing_complex.h \
 		lib/libmissing.a lib/libmissing.so \
 		lib/libmissing.so.${SHLIB_MAJOR}
 
-SHLIB_MAJOR=	1
+SHLIB_MAJOR=	2
 SRCS=		libmissing.c
 
 CFLAGS+=	-fno-builtin -fno-math-errno -I. -I${LOCALBASE}/include

Modified: head/math/libmissing/distinfo
==============================================================================
--- head/math/libmissing/distinfo	Thu Aug 15 21:37:32 2013	(r324785)
+++ head/math/libmissing/distinfo	Thu Aug 15 22:13:42 2013	(r324786)
@@ -1,2 +1,2 @@
-SHA256 (libmissing-20121222.tar.xz) = 5656e15609c1ec4d1ff58b81691e9c5926f6aa067d758eff5e4c7b12c14bb3eb
-SIZE (libmissing-20121222.tar.xz) = 130312
+SHA256 (libmissing-20130815.tar.xz) = 44872006f607c34e0a85dd18a3c890d2f380fbcd87b885fdb5a17b46e1a3f422
+SIZE (libmissing-20130815.tar.xz) = 130232



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201308152213.r7FMDggR040206>